  1. Dominique Davalos (born November 5, 1965) is American musician, rock singer and bass player formerly in the band Dominatrix, whose controversial music video single "The Dominatrix Sleeps Tonight", released in 1984, was deemed too racy for its time.

  3. Dominique Davalos was born on 5 November 1965 in Los Angeles, California, USA. She is an actress and composer, known for Howard the Duck (1986), A Woman Under the Influence (1974) and Salvation! (1987).
